Video footage posted on Telegram Saturday, Aug. 10 allegedly shows Ukrainian soldiers having entered Russia's Belgorod region.
Video was filmed in front of a community arts center in the Belgorod region village of Poroz.
Soldiers from Ukraine's 252nd Battalion held up Ukrainian and Georgian flags after capturing the village.
A unit of the Ukrainian 252nd Battalion appears to have entered the village of Poroz in Russia's Belgorod Oblast
